Ok so i know to expect some sediment in the bottle if im bottle conditioning and carbing, and i was expecting some slimy stuff... but i can see a white kinda flaky looking thing sitting in the bottom of some of the bottles... Im worried its bacteria. There seems to be only one per bottle that ive seen, and its not big but its not small either. It also looks white... It doesn't float, but sometimes pours out of the bottle when i pour it. Is this dead yeast or something bad?
 
Can you post a picture? This is the interwebs and on the interwebs it don't exist if there ain't no picture. :)

And I agree, it is probably yeast. Just remember, no micro-organisms that can exist in beer can kill you. :)
 
Yeast. I pour all but the last half inch or so, so as to enjoy a nice clear (sort of) glass. Then I chug the bottle. It's all good.
